H-1B visa issue: We’re going to keep using our visa programmes, says U.S. Department of Homeland Security

A day after U.S. President Donald Trump defended H-1B visas, Secretary of Department of Homeland Security Kristi Noem said America is going to keep using the visa programmes and noted that more foreign-born people are becoming naturalised citizens under the Trump administration. “We’re going to keep using our visa programmes.
